Sorry, no more filters found for current selection!
17 Laxton Cl, Melton Mowbray LE13 1LT, United Kingdom
Bowling Green, Melton Mowbray, Leics LE13 0FA
Scalford Rd, Melton Mowbray LE13 1LH, United Kingdom
Melton Osteopathic & Sports Injury Clinic, Melton Mowbray LE13 1NX, United Kingdom
Meltonshire Badminton Club, Melton Mowbray LE13 1DR, United Kingdom